This project is specifically for the DNA methylation and genotyping component of the FIERCE study of Syrian mother and child pairs of refugees in Jordan taking part in the We Love Reading (WLR) intervention. The current study will investigate whether and how the effect of the We Love Reading (WLR) intervention program gets “under the skin” of refugee children and their mothers in Jordan. To this end, we will examine differences in genetic and epigenetic markers (specifically, DNA methylation) between the intervention and control groups. Using an epigenetic biomarker of biological aging as well as an exploratory epigenome-wide approach, we will identify epigenetic changes associated with WLR. Post-hoc analysis will be conducted to scrutinize how biological findings may associate with underlying genotypic differences, as well as map onto children’s socioemotional outcomes and maternal mental health and wellbeing. We will further examine the role that family dynamics play in these aforementioned relationships and how family dynamics (specifically parenting and mental health) are reflected in DNA methylation as well.
